To view a copy of this licence, visit http://creativecommons.org/licenses/by/4.0/. Silva P, Travassos B, Vilar L, Aguiar P, Davids K, Arajo D, et al. Kelso JAS. By identifying critical sources of information that support utilisation of relevant affordances (defined as opportunities for action, see [31]), a coach can carefully design learning activities that represent or faithfully simulate competition demands. Some examples of questioning to promote self-regulation being actualised may include (but are not de-limited to) the following: Questioning that draws player attention towards number inequalities (overloads or underloads) in certain field locations. From an ecological ontology, self-regulation refers to the development and exploitation of deeply intertwined, functional relationships between a performers actions, perceptions, intentions, emotions and the environment [6].
